【校招VIP】出品:JAVA语言快速入门2022版

本课程出自【校招VIP】原创内容,请勿擅自转载,java(考点课程)「JAVA语言快速入门2022版」持续更新中......

查看课程:https://xiaozhao.vip/course/class/139

或者关注【校招VIP】小程序,进入课程频道查看。

 

一、课程介绍

  1. java的就业形势:依然是校招开发招聘人数TOP的职位之一
  2. 更简单的一门外语:java与英语快速比较
  3. 语言入门的三道槛:入门有快慢,不要轻易放弃
  4. 【重要】自学难坚持:加入“组团学”一起学习和讨论
  5. 课程特点:跟计算机专业学习对比
  6. 本课程的终点:能够正常实现语言逻辑
  7. 开发环境:intelliJ IDEA下载和使用
  8. 别人做好的车轮:JDK的理解和安装
  9. 运行第一个小程序:输出Hello world

二、基本数据类型和运算符

  1. 单词级别:基本数据类型和2进制
  2. 新名词:变量、常量和直接写数字
  3. 加减乘除:运算符和优先级
  4. lang包:控制台输入和输出(I/O)
  5. 作业1:不带优先级的简单计算器
  6. 作业2:带优先级的计算器(组团学)

三、简单类和方法

  1. 提取重复:方法的理解和使用
  2. 类和对象:java是面向对象的语言
  3. 基本数据类型的包装类:自动装箱和解箱
  4. 最常用内置类:String类的理解和初始化
  5. 新难点:== 和 equals
  6. String类和数字的相互转换
  7. 常用内置类:Date类理解

四、数组、列表和逻辑分支

  1. 固定长度一组数据:数组
  2. 机器最擅长:循环
  3. 数组循环:查询和逻辑
  4. 控制逻辑:if else
  5. 不固定长度的一组数据:列表
  6. 列表和数组的转化
  7. 简单排序之冒泡排序
  8. 列表的排序方法使用
  9. 二重数据和二重循环(不重要)

五、到了需要debug的时候

  1. 监控异常:try catch
  2. debug方法使用:执行中的数据跟踪

六、常用容器

  1. 键值对:map的理解和使用
  2. Map的循环
  3. Set的理解和使用

七、类和对象 

  1. 多个类型封装:对象的概念和构造方法
  2. 两个对象列表的合并
  3. 接口和继承(入门不重要)
  4. public、protected、private
  5. 实战1:学生课程成绩对象构建
  6. 实战2:学生成绩数据统计

八、数据库的引入

  1. mysql驱动:程序访问起来
  2. sql查询语句:增删改查
  3. SQL的分页和排序
  4. 多表关联操作

九、后话

  1. 课程结束了,但是入门练习还要坚持
  2. Springboot web的学习课程介绍
posted @ 2022-05-18 10:06  校招VIP  阅读(46)  评论(0编辑  收藏  举报